A New Friend.

This ain’t no Sunday walk, she’s leading me

Destination a mystery

There’s someone I want you to meet

Ok, but aren’t you gonna tell me?

PC

Here comes that slippery slide.

What is this meeting that she has conspired?

She has a twinkle in her eye

But she won’t tell me why

CH

We have a day-full of hours and some seconds to spend

Come with me and meet a new friend

It’s a good day, to greet a new friend

Babe,

you’ll remember this day

She steers us down to the bus exchange

And buys two tickets to the beach

I get two colas from the coke machine

And hold them up just out of her reach

C’mon who is it, why don’t you tell?

I rack my brain then try to rack hers

We get on the bus, with its sticky smell

She says it’s nothing bad, It could be worse

CH

We sit on the shore by the boardwalk

I see she’s too excited to talk

She shows me a blurry black and white

There’s no detail, I don’t see the light

So it doesn’t click at first

And she’s got a poker face

Then she places my hand on her belly

and it all falls into place

It falls right into place

CH

OUTRO

I’m gonna love him

Or is it a her?

I’m gonna remember this day.
